Posted Fri 21 Aug 2020 10.38 by OhNo_NotAgain? (edited Sat 22 Aug 2020 15.25 by OhNo_NotAgain?)

Headhunter: in England the prescription charge is UKPounds 9.15 I believe. So only you can know if that is cheaper than the price you paid. As for whether or not you CAN get it prescribed (or perhaps in a larger tube, say 30g), that would be a question to ask your GP. Good luck.
